Critical perspectives focus on class struggle, global inequality, and exploitation. This lens views international economic structures—like global supply chains—as mechanisms that enrich core developed nations at the expense of peripheral developing nations. 3. Nationalism views the global economy as a zero-sum game where economic power directly translates to military and political security. States must actively manage trade, protect domestic industries, and maximize exports to accumulate national wealth. Marxism (Critical Theories)
